Output 57c827996a16798327bb1de25a5e64f7434d31662b1ba1239c6ad531506ee81f:10

value
321763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65577fe104aaf4d7c6af20f2cb6fdacca173314f OP_EQUAL
address
3AvrzVWZPoz8uL9BCuxUaS64YcQzLCPoer
transaction
57c827996a16798327bb1de25a5e64f7434d31662b1ba1239c6ad531506ee81f
spent
true